CHARGE SENSING APPARATUS OF TOUCH PANEL THAT REMOVED AN OFFSET CHARGE AND LOW FREQUENCY NOISE THEREOF, REDUCING LOW FREQUENCY NOISE GENERATED BY NOISE INCLUDED IN SIGNAL ITSELF AND A TOUCH OF PANEL AND CONDUCTOR

PURPOSE: A charge sensing apparatus of touch panel that removed an offset charge and low frequency noise is provided to guarantee sufficient sensitivity to catch a small change of charge and minimizing the noise.;CONSTITUTION: A charge sensing apparatus of touch panel(100) comprises a signal transmitting unit(110), a capacitance sensor(120), a signal receiver(130), a noise eliminator(140), and an automatic compensator(160). The signal transmitting unit outputs by generating sensing signal that includes information about the sampling point. The capacitance sensor receives the sensing signal through an input terminal. The capacitance sensor outputs the first charge and the second charge repetitively in order, through an output terminal. The automatic compensator, by using the charge outputted, generates a plurality of offset control signals to set offset charge quantity. The automatic compensator outputs by generating the first modified charge and the second modified charge, responding to the offset control signals; the first modified charge is calculated by removing offset charge from the first charge and the second modified charge is calculated by removing offset charge from the second charge. The signal receiver outputs the first cumulated voltage and the second cumulated voltage by sampling the first modified charge and the second modified charge in N times respectively, and controlling gain. The noise eliminator calculates the difference of the first cumulated voltage and the second cumulated voltage, after receiving the first cumulate voltage and the second cumulate voltage sequentially. The noise eliminator outputs the low frequency noise removed voltage difference which is generated by touching the conductor on the touch panel.;COPYRIGHT KIPO 2013;[Reference numerals] (110) Signal transmitting unit; (131) Sampling unit; (133) First charge accumulation unit; (134) Second charge accumulation unit; (135) Gain controller; (143) CDS controller; (145) CDC unit; (160) Automatic compensator
